在Windowsfrom中开发
时间: 2024-06-04 16:07:12 浏览: 8
在Windows Form中开发可以使用C#或VB.NET编程语言。首先,您需要安装Visual Studio集成开发环境(IDE),它包括Windows Form应用程序项目模板和可视化设计器。然后,您可以使用设计器创建用户界面,并在代码中添加事件处理程序和业务逻辑。您还可以使用 .NET Framework提供的各种控件和类来实现您的应用程序的功能。在开发过程中,您可以使用调试工具来诊断和解决问题,并使用发布向导将应用程序部署到目标计算机上。
相关问题
在Windowsfrom中开发GMAP
在 Windows Form 应用程序中使用 GMap 控件进行地图开发,需要进行以下步骤:
1. 下载 GMap 控件包,并将其添加到项目中。
2. 在 Form 中添加 GMap 控件。
3. 在代码中设置 GMap 控件的属性,例如地图类型、缩放级别、中心点等。
4. 使用 GMap 控件提供的方法和事件来操作地图,例如添加标记、绘制路线等。
以下是一个简单的示例代码,演示如何在 Windows Form 应用程序中使用 GMap 控件显示地图:
```c#
using GMap.NET;
using GMap.NET.MapProviders;
using GMap.NET.WindowsForms;
public partial class MainForm : Form
{
private GMapControl gMapControl;
public MainForm()
{
InitializeComponent();
// 创建 GMap 控件
gMapControl = new GMapControl();
// 设置地图类型和缩放级别
gMapControl.MapProvider = GMapProviders.GoogleMap;
gMapControl.MinZoom = 0;
gMapControl.MaxZoom = 24;
gMapControl.Zoom = 10;
// 设置中心点和位置
PointLatLng center = new PointLatLng(39.915527, 116.397183);
gMapControl.Position = center;
// 添加 GMap 控件到窗口
Controls.Add(gMapControl);
}
}
```
在上面的代码中,我们创建了一个 GMapControl 对象,设置了地图类型、缩放级别和中心点,并将其添加到窗口中。你可以根据自己的需求修改代码,添加更多的功能,例如添加标记、绘制路线等。
在windows上开发python使用docker发布到centos
要在 Windows 上开发 Python 并将其发布到 CentOS,可以使用 Docker 容器化应用程序的方式。以下是一些步骤:
1. 在 Windows 上安装 Docker Desktop。在 Docker Desktop 中启动 Docker。
2. 使用 Dockerfile 创建一个 Docker 镜像,其中包括所需的 Python 环境和应用程序代码。例如,以下是一个示例 Dockerfile:
```
FROM python:3.8.1-alpine
WORKDIR /app
COPY requirements.txt .
RUN pip install --no-cache-dir -r requirements.txt
COPY . .
CMD [ "python", "./app.py" ]
```
3. 将 Dockerfile 放在项目根目录中,并在命令行中导航到该目录。然后使用以下命令构建 Docker 镜像:
```
docker build -t myapp .
```
这将在本地构建名为“myapp”的 Docker 镜像。
4. 现在,您可以将 Docker 镜像推送到 Docker Hub 或私有 Docker Registry 中。使用以下命令登录到 Docker Hub:
```
docker login
```
5. 将 Docker 镜像推送到 Docker Hub:
```
docker tag myapp username/myapp
docker push username/myapp
```
6. 在 CentOS 中安装 Docker,并在命令行中使用以下命令从 Docker Hub 拉取 Docker 镜像:
```
docker pull username/myapp
```
7. 运行 Docker 镜像:
```
docker run -d -p 5000:5000 --name myapp username/myapp
```
这将在 CentOS 中启动名为“myapp”的 Docker 容器,并将其映射到本地端口 5000。
8. 现在,您可以使用浏览器或其他工具访问在 CentOS 中运行的 Python 应用程序。例如,如果您将应用程序绑定到本地端口 5000,则可以在浏览器中输入“http://localhost:5000”来访问该应用程序。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)